tsunami

by @relishrain

as i put you in the back of my mind and try to forget try to move on i can't as i stare at her with her blonde hair and wax to her my affection which is there... but not this affection i feel for her and her sandy hair is like a pebbles ripples compared to the tsunami of muddy brown eyes and hair that you are
